Acerca de esta escucha

Detective Isaac Bell returns, in the thrilling new adventure from the number-one New York Times best-selling author.

On the ocean liner Mauretania, two European scientists with a dramatic new invention are barely rescued from abduction by the Van Dorn Detective Agency's intrepid chief investigator, Isaac Bell. Unfortunately, they are not so lucky the second time. The thugs attack again - and this time, one of the scientists dies.

What are they holding that is so precious? Only something that will revolutionize business and popular culture - and perhaps something more. For war clouds are looming, and a ruthless espionage agent has spotted a priceless opportunity to give the Germans an edge. It is up to Isaac Bell to figure out who he is, what he is up to, and to stop him. But he may already be too late... and the future of the world may just hang in the balance.

©2012 Clive Cussler (P)2012 Penguin

With The Gangster, the 9th book in the Isaac Bell series, being released in 3 days, I'm trying to make it through the prior 8 novels before the release. The Thief is Book 5 in this wonderful historical thriller series. It appear to be set in the year 1912. Isaac Bell and Marion finally get married on a cruise ship crossing the Atlantic to New York.

The twin themes of the book are Germany's preparation for war and the transitioning of the motion picture industry from silent films to "talkies" which is being enabled by the invention of a device that allows for synchronization of sound with video. The inventors, a German professor and his star student, are aboard the cruise ship. Also aboard is the thief who is determined to steal the invention.

This is a complex novel with almost continuous action and suspense. The action begins on the Cunard Line's Mauretania, goes to New York then to DC, then to San Francisco, then back to New York and finally back to the Mauretania cruise ship. Marion plays a bigger role in The Thief than in prior books in the series.

A historical point: The Thief exposes Thomas Edison as more a thief of technology than as an inventor. That is historically accurate. Thus the title of the book could be referring to Edison as much as the German "acrobat" who is seeking to steal the motion picture technology.

My mild disappointment with The Thief is that the plot is a little too complex. The authors handle it well, but the listener must pay very close attention to avoid getting lost.

Scott Brick's narration is flawless.
